Overview of Spain's Economic Landscape
Spain's economic landscape is a complex tapestry of historical influences, regional diversity, and modern challenges. As the fourth-largest economy in the European Union (EU) by GDP, Spain has seen significant growth in the post-financial crisis era, particularly driven by sectors such as tourism, manufacturing, and renewable energy. However, the country faces persistent structural issues, one of which is the **skills shortage**—a phenomenon that has a profound impact on its ability to sustain and accelerate economic growth.
The Spanish economy is characterized by its **dual nature**, with a strong emphasis on services alongside pockets of industrial and agricultural activity. Services account for approximately 75% of Spain's GDP, with tourism being a cornerstone. Spain is one of the world's most visited countries, attracting over 80 million tourists annually before the pandemic. This industry not only supports direct employment in hospitality but also fuels demand in related sectors such as retail, transportation, and food production. However, the heavy reliance on tourism exposes the economy to external shocks, as seen during the COVID-19 pandemic, which caused a sharp contraction in this sector.
In addition to tourism, Spain has a robust **manufacturing base**, particularly in the automotive and aerospace industries. Companies like SEAT, a subsidiary of Volkswagen, and Airbus have significant operations in Spain. These industries are highly dependent on skilled labor, particularly in engineering, design, and technical maintenance roles. The **automotive sector alone contributes about 10% of Spain's GDP** and is a major exporter, but it is increasingly challenged by the global shift toward electric vehicles (EVs) and the need for specialized skills in battery technology, software integration, and sustainable manufacturing practices. This transition has amplified the existing skills gap, as traditional manufacturing roles are becoming obsolete while new, highly technical roles remain unfilled due to a lack of adequately trained professionals.
Another critical sector is **renewable energy**, where Spain has positioned itself as a leader in Europe. The country has made significant investments in wind and solar energy, aiming to meet its ambitious target of achieving carbon neutrality by 2050. This green transition has created demand for engineers, project managers, and technicians with expertise in renewable energy systems. However, Spain is grappling with a shortage of such professionals. According to industry reports, there is a **disconnect between the education system and the labor market needs**, with universities and vocational training programs lagging behind in equipping students with the technical skills required for these emerging fields. This mismatch not only hinders the growth of the renewable energy sector but also limits Spain's capacity to capitalize on the green economy as a driver of long-term economic resilience.
The **construction industry**, which played a central role in Spain's pre-2008 economic boom, has also seen a resurgence in recent years due to infrastructure projects and urban development. Yet, this sector faces a persistent shortage of skilled workers such as electricians, plumbers, and construction managers. Many of these roles require not just technical know-how but also a familiarity with modern building standards, including energy efficiency and smart infrastructure. The lack of a sufficiently skilled workforce has led to project delays and increased costs, further straining Spain's ability to meet its infrastructure goals.

Government Policies and the Skills Shortage List
The Spanish government has implemented a range of policies and programs to address the growing **skills shortage** in critical sectors of the economy. These initiatives aim to bridge the gap between the demand for skilled labor and the availability of qualified professionals, particularly in industries such as technology, healthcare, construction, and education. By leveraging migration programs, financial incentives, and workforce development strategies, Spain is attempting to position itself as a competitive player in the global labor market while simultaneously supporting domestic economic growth.
One of the key mechanisms the Spanish government employs to tackle the skills shortage is the **Official List of Shortage Occupations** (Catalogo de Ocupaciones de Dificil Cobertura). This list, updated quarterly by the Public Employment Service (SEPE), identifies occupations where there is a demonstrable lack of local talent. Employers can use this list to streamline the process of hiring non-EU workers for roles that cannot be filled domestically. While this list is not exclusive to Spanish-speaking roles, it often includes positions in sectors like engineering, IT, and specialized trades where bilingual or multilingual skills—including Spanish—are highly desirable. This demonstrates how the government recognizes the intersection of **language proficiency** and **technical expertise** as a means to address labor market imbalances.
The **immigration policies** tied to the shortage list are a critical component of this strategy. Non-EU professionals who qualify for roles on the list can benefit from a simplified visa application process under the **Regulation of the Immigration Law (Ley de Extranjeria)**. For example, skilled workers such as software developers, nurses, or construction engineers can obtain a work permit more easily if their role is listed as hard to fill. This approach not only attracts international talent but also helps Spain maintain its competitive edge in industries where local talent is insufficient. However, this policy is not without challenges. Critics argue that the list is sometimes too narrowly focused or slow to adapt to rapidly changing labor market needs, particularly in fast-evolving fields like AI and renewable energy. To address this, the government has recently introduced **dynamic review mechanisms** to ensure the list remains responsive to sector-specific demands.

Case Studies: Success Stories and Lessons Learned
The Spanish skills shortage list highlights critical areas where the labor market faces a deficit of qualified professionals. This challenge is particularly pronounced in industries like technology, healthcare, and renewable energy. While the shortage poses significant hurdles, some companies and regions in Spain have demonstrated innovative and effective approaches to mitigate these gaps. This section explores case studies of such success stories, offering unique insights into the strategies employed and the lessons learned.
One notable example is **Barcelona's tech ecosystem**, which has become a hub for startups and multinational tech companies despite the country's broader skills shortage in IT and software development. The region has leveraged a combination of public-private partnerships and targeted educational initiatives to address its talent needs. For instance, **Mobile World Capital Barcelona**, an initiative tied to the city's hosting of the Mobile World Congress, has played a pivotal role. Through programs like **mSchools**, the organization collaborates with schools and universities to introduce coding and digital skills into the curriculum. This not only creates a pipeline of future talent but also helps local companies access entry-level developers trained in relevant technologies.
Additionally, Barcelona has seen success through **coding bootcamps** such as Ironhack and CodeOp, which focus on reskilling professionals from non-technical backgrounds. These bootcamps offer intensive, short-term training in high-demand areas like web development, data science, and UX design. Companies like **Glovo**, a Barcelona-based delivery app, have actively recruited from these programs, filling mid-level developer roles with individuals who transitioned from fields like marketing or hospitality. This approach highlights the importance of flexible, non-traditional education pathways in addressing immediate labor needs.
Another compelling case comes from the **healthcare sector in Andalusia**, where a shortage of specialized nurses and technicians has been a persistent issue. The region implemented a **dual training model** inspired by Germany's vocational education system. Hospitals like **Hospital Universitario Virgen del Rocío** in Seville partnered with local vocational schools to offer hands-on training alongside classroom instruction. This model ensures that students are not only academically prepared but also gain practical experience in real healthcare settings. As a result, the region has seen a 20% increase in the retention of newly certified nurses within the public healthcare system over the past five years. This approach underscores the value of embedding workplace experience into education to create a workforce that is both skilled and job-ready.
In the **renewable energy sector**, the Basque Country provides an example of how regional specialization can address skill shortages. The area is home to **Tecnalia**, a leading research and technology organization, which collaborates with local universities and companies to develop tailored training programs for the green energy industry. One successful initiative involved creating a **"Green Energy Talent Hub"**, where engineers and technicians were trained in emerging fields like offshore wind energy and hydrogen production. Companies such as **Iberdrola** and **Siemens Gamesa** actively supported these programs by offering internships and co-funding research projects. This collaboration not only bridged the skills gap but also positioned the Basque Country as a leader in Europe's green energy transition. A key lesson here is the power of **regional specialization**—focusing on industries where the region has a competitive edge can create a self-reinforcing cycle of talent attraction and retention.
A less conventional but equally impactful example comes from **rural areas in Galicia**, where agriculture and fisheries face labor shortages due to an aging population and urban migration. To address this, the regional government launched the **"Redeiras Program"**, which focuses on upskilling women in coastal communities. Traditionally, these women were involved in manual tasks like net-mending but were not considered part of the formal workforce. The program provided training in modern fishing technologies, aquaculture management, and even digital marketing for seafood products. Companies like **Pescanova** supported the initiative by offering contracts to trained participants. This not only mitigated the labor shortage but also empowered underrepresented groups, demonstrating how targeted inclusivity can address workforce challenges while promoting social equity.
